Kevin Layer <[email protected]> writes: > Also, I didn't like the solution of having to provide a definition of > this method along with an asd file. It seems like a hack. It may seem like a hack when taken in terms of other system definition tools, but for ASDF it isn't really. Or at least it is a hack by design. ;-) ASDF is intended to be extended and customized via its own protocol, of which OUTPUT-FILES is a part.
